2. Industrial Applications & Functional Advantages
This heterocyclic compound serves as critical building block in:
- Pharmaceutical intermediates (kinase inhibitor synthesis)
- Agrochemical precursors (pesticide formulation)
- Liquid crystal material development
- Cross-coupling reactions (Suzuki-Miyaura applications)
3. Operational Protocols & Safety Guidelines
Standard handling requirements include:
- Storage: Nitrogen atmosphere at 2-8°C
- PPE: Chemical-resistant gloves & vapor masks
- Incompatibilities: Strong oxidizers, alkaline metals
- Waste disposal: Halogenated solvent protocols
